Output 43ace0415a435887741efe020ae4061038425ee6e392bc8ec98cac1448183be1:0

value
21656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c9b01b63158882dee8a871f6530cb4d8078ef0a OP_EQUAL
address
32qfiu6ohLbSEM9pQRthCucY4o2UXKmNDG
transaction
43ace0415a435887741efe020ae4061038425ee6e392bc8ec98cac1448183be1
spent
true